How can I get an advance, without receiving my w2 yet?

TurboTax offers an advance that is paid on a prepaid debit card, but only after you file a completed tax return and that return is accepted by the IRS. It’s basically a bridge loan for the three weeks it takes the IRS to process a regular refund.  Since the IRS is not accepting tax returns yet, and  you can’t file without your W-2, TurboTax does not offer any type of loan that meets your requirements.
